.relative__{position:relative;z-index:1;}.f-left{float:left;}.f-right{float:right;}.clear__:after{content:'';display:block;float:none;clear:both;}.desktop__,.desktop_tablet__{display:block;}.desktop__inline_block,.desktop_tablet__inline_block{display:inline-block;}.tablet__,.mobile__,.tablet_mobile__{display:none;}.tablet__inline_block,.mobile__inline_block,.tablet_mobile__inline_block{display:none;}.ab__y{position:absolute;top:0px;left:0px;height:100%;display:block;width:100%;}.menu_mobile{width:100%;height:100%;position:fixed;left:0px;background:#ad8f13;z-index:999;box-sizing:border-box;padding:70px 0px 0px;display:none;}.menu_mobile div{position:relative;}.menu_mobile a{display:block;color:white;height:55px;text-align:center;font-size:1.5em;line-height:2.5;}.menu_mobile a.active{color:#784e28;}@media all and (max-width: 1220px){.padding__{padding-left:20px !important;padding-right:20px !important;box-sizing:border-box;}}@media all and (max-width: 785px){.desktop__,.desktop__inline_block{display:none;}.tablet__,.tablet_mobile__{display:block;}.tablet__inline_block,.tablet__inline_block{display:inline-block;}}@media all and (max-width: 640px){.desktop_tablet__,.desktop_tablet__inline_block,.tablet__{display:none;}.mobile__{display:block;}.mobile__inline_block{display:inline-block;}}.banner__ img{max-width:100%;width:100%;height:auto;}.oneline{text-overflow:ellipsis;white-space:nowrap;width:100%;overflow:hidden;}.clear{clear:both;float:left;}.inline-block{display:inline-block;}.justify{text-align:justify;text-justify:inter-ideograph;-ms-text-justify:inter-ideograph;}.w-fix{display:inline-block;width:100%;height:0;vertical-align:middle;}.container{max-width:1200px;margin:auto;position:relative;}header,#content,footer{width:100%;float:left;clear:both;}header{height:134px;box-sizing:border-box;padding:30px 0px;background:rgba(238,174,14,0.95);position:absolute;top:0px;left:0px;z-index:20;}.logo2{height:58px;margin-left:20px;margin-top:16px;}#content{min-height:500px;}.menu_desktop ul li a:hover{color:#002d56;}.nnn{background:url('/img/bg_logo_icon.png') no-repeat;background-size:cover;opacity:0.5;}.header_left{float:left;width:calc(100% - 650px);}.header_right{float:right;width:650px;}.header_search_lang_box{float:right;}.header_search_lang_box a,.lang_box a{font-size:13px;font-weight:900;background:#858749;color:white;width:30px;height:30px;text-align:center;line-height:30px;display:inline-block;}.header_search_lang_box a.active,.lang_box a.active{background:#002d56;color:white;}.menu_desktop{margin-top:55px;}.menu_desktop ul li{list-style:none;float:right;margin-left:45px;position:relative;}.menu_desktop ul li:last-child{margin-left:0px;}.menu_desktop ul li a{font-size:15px;display:inline-block;height:33px;font-weight:700;color:#5d5f25;font-family:"Montserrat";}.menu_desktop ul li.active a{color:#002d56;}.menu_mobile div{position:relative;}.menu_desktop ul li p{display:none;position:absolute;top:32px;left:-21px;z-index:10;background:red;}.header_search_lang_box a:nth-child(1){margin-right:5px;}.menu_desktop  p:hover{display:block;}.show_menu:hover +p{display:block;}.show_menu:hover p{display:block;}.menu_desktop ul li p a{display:block;width:140px;height:35px;line-height:35px;background:#e4dfc9;color:black !important;padding:5px 15px;font-weight:100 !important;}.menu_desktop ul li p a:hover,.menu_desktop ul li p a.active{background:#bb9624;color:white !important;}.lang_box{text-align:center;margin-top:37px;}.lang_box a:nth-of-type(1){margin-right:25px;}.menu_mobile{width:100%;height:100%;position:fixed;left:0px;background-color:#ebebeb;z-index:999;box-sizing:border-box;padding:50px 0px 0px;display:none;}.menu_mobile .menu_item a{display:block;color:#5d5f25;height:70px;text-align:center;font-size:20px;line-height:70px;font-family:Montserrat;font-weight:600;}.menu_mobile  .menu_item a.active{color:#002d56;}.menu_mobile p{background:#e4dfc9;}.menu_mobile p a{color:black;}.menu_mobile_button{width:30px;height:30px;display:none;position:absolute;bottom:4px;right:22px;}.text__{font-size:40px;color:white;font-family:Folks-Bold;position:absolute;bottom:31%;left:19%;}footer{box-sizing:border-box;background:#858748;padding:35px 0px;position:relative;}footer .footer_left{width:60%;float:left;}footer .footer_left a{color:white;font-size:16px;margin-right:35px;display:inline-block;margin-bottom:13px;}footer .footer_left p{color:white;font-size:16px;}footer .footer_left a:last-child{margin-right:0px;}footer a,footer p{position:relative;padding-left:35px;box-sizing:border-box;}footer .tel:before{content:'';display:inline-block;width:26px;height:26px;background:url('/img/icon_tel.svg') no-repeat center;background-size:contain;position:absolute;left:0px;top:-2px;}/*953795e33e25c16a067bcfa2a5842f5b*/footer .fax:before{content:'';display:inline-block;width:26px;height:26px;background:url('/img/icon_fax.svg') no-repeat center;background-size:contain;position:absolute;left:0px;top:-1px;}footer .email:before{content:'';display:inline-block;width:26px;height:26px;background:url('/img/icon_email.svg') no-repeat center;background-size:contain;position:absolute;left:0px;top:-2px;}footer .address:before{content:'';display:inline-block;width:26px;height:26px;background:url('/img/icon_address.svg') no-repeat center;background-size:contain;position:absolute;left:0px;top:-2px;}.footer_right{float:right;width:40%;margin-top:17px;}.footer_right_top{text-align:right;margin-bottom:17px;}.footer_right_top a{text-align:right;margin-right:10px;padding-left:0px;}.footer_right_top a:last-child{margin-right:0px;}.footer_right_bottom{margin-top:11px;}.footer_right_bottom p{color:white;text-align:right;font-size:12px;font-family:"Montserrat";font-weight:300;}.footer_right_bottom a{color:white;}footer .footer_left a.email{margin-right:0px;}.content_padding{padding-top:74px;padding-bottom:78px;}.bg{overflow:hidden;position:relative;}.bg___,.bg___mobile{width:100%;height:100%;position:absolute !important;top:0px;left:0px;background-image:url("/img/bg_logo_icon.png");background-repeat:no-repeat;background-color:transparent;background-size:85%;opacity:0.1;z-index:-1;}.bg___mobile{background-image:url("/img/bg_logo_icon_mobile.png");}.bg___index{top:0%;left:31%;}.bg___contact{background-position-x:center;left:26%;top:51%;background-size:100%;}@media all and (max-width: 1200px){.menu_desktop{display:none;}.menu_mobile_button{display:inline-block;}.header_search_lang_box{display:none;}.header_right{width:12%;}header{padding-right:20px;}.banner__{height:400px;}.content_padding{padding:20px;}}@media all and (max-width: 785px){footer .footer_left,footer .footer_right,.footer_right_top,.footer_right_bottom{width:100%;float:none;}footer .footer_left a,footer .footer_left p{margin-left:18px;}.footer_right_top,.footer_right_bottom p{text-align:center;}footer .footer_left{margin-top:15px;}.footer_right{margin-top:52px;}footer .footer_left a.fax{margin-right:0px;}.bg___{display:none;}.bg___mobile{display:block;background-size:200%;}.bg___index{top:0px;left:0px;background-position:17% -24%;}}@media all and (max-width: 640px){.bg___menu{background-size:150%;background-position-x:43%;}.logo1{height:50px;}.logo2{height:40px;margin-top:6px;margin-left:15px;}header{height:100px;padding-right:0px;}.menu_mobile_button{bottom:15px;right:25px;}footer{padding:32px 0px;}footer .footer_left{margin-top:0px;}footer .footer_left a,footer .footer_left p{margin-left:0px;}footer .footer_left a{margin-bottom:17px;}.footer_right{margin-top:62px;}}@media all and (max-width: 410px){.logo1{height:40px;}.logo2{height:30px;}.menu_mobile_button{bottom:5px;}}.button_{cursor:pointer;}.content__left{float:left;}.content__left .content__left_box{background:#f6f6f6;padding:20px 30px;width:345px;box-sizing:border-box;}.category_top{font-size:16px;font-family:Montserrat;font-weight:700;color:#002d56;height:56px;line-height:56px;}.category_top_li{border-bottom:1px solid #ffb400;}.category_top span{display:inline-block;max-width:95%;}.category_top i,.button_notop{display:inline-block;float:right;width:16px;height:16px;}.button_top,.button_notop{margin-top:20px;}.category_top.more i{background:url("/img/button_cat_more.png") no-repeat center;}.category_top.less i{background:url("/img/button_cat_less.png") no-repeat center;}.category_son{min-height:56px;line-height:56px;font-family:Montserrat;font-size:16px;position:relative;}.category_son span{display:inline-block;padding-left:30px;position:relative;line-height:25px;width:100%;padding-right:20px;box-sizing:border-box;color:#002d56;}.category_son.more a{background:url("/img/button_cat_more2.png") no-repeat center;}.category_son.less a{background:url("/img/button_cat_less2.png") no-repeat center;}.category_top_li > a{color:#002d56;}.category_top_li:last-child{border-bottom:0px;}li.hide__{height:0px;overflow:hidden;}.content__left ul li{list-style:none;}.content__right.category{float:right;width:calc(100% - 378px);}.content__right.category ul li{list-style:none;width:33.33333333%;float:left;text-align:center;margin-bottom:28px;padding:10px;box-sizing:border-box;cursor:pointer;}.content__right.category ul li div{padding-bottom:100%;background-repeat:no-repeat;background-position:center;background-size:contain;}.content__right.category ul li a{display:inline-block;color:#464646;font-size:16px;margin-top:5px;height:38px;}.content__right.category .category_title,.content__right.products_info .category_title{display:none;}.category_title{font-size:30px;font-weight:700;color:#002d56;margin-bottom:30px;}.content__right.products,.content__right.products_info{float:right;width:calc(100% - 391px);}.content__right.products .category_title{display:block;}.content__right.products ul li{list-style:none;margin-bottom:55px;width:50%;float:left;}.product_list_left{float:left;width:49%;padding:0px 10px;box-sizing:border-box;}.product_image{height:250px;background-repeat:no-repeat;background-position:center;background-size:contain;border:1px solid #858749;}.product_list_right{float:right;width:48%;}.product_title{font-size:20px;font-family:Montserrat;font-weight:600;margin-bottom:10px;line-height:28px;}.product_short_desc{font-size:16px;max-height:152px;margin-bottom:20px;overflow:hidden;line-height:30px;}a.detail_button{font-size:14px;color:white;background:#ffb400;display:inline-block;width:121px;height:41px;text-align:center;line-height:41px;font-family:Montserrat;font-weight:600;}.not_data{font-size:20px;text-align:left;}.content__right.products_info ul li{list-style:none;}.product_desc{margin-bottom:20px;}.more span:before,a[show_products='0'].more span:after,.less span:before,a[show_products='0'].less span:after{content:'';width:16px;height:16px;display:inline-block;vertical-align:text-top;margin-top:5px;position:absolute;}.more span:before,.less span:before{left:0px;top:0px;}.more span:after,.less span:after{right:0px;top:0px;}.more span:before{background:url("/img/arrow_blue.png") no-repeat center;}a[show_products='0'].more span:after{background:url("/img/button_cat_more2.png") no-repeat center;}.less span:before{background:url("/img/arrow_yellow.png") no-repeat center;}a[show_products='0'].less span:after{background:url("/img/button_cat_less2.png") no-repeat center;}a[data-level='0'].less span:before,a[data-level='0'].more span:before{display:none;}.content__left{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;}.level2{margin-left:20px;}.content__right.products_info ul li{width:100%;}.product_info_img{text-align:center;padding:10px;box-sizing:border-box;border:1px solid #858749;margin-bottom:20px;}.product_info_img img{max-width:100%;height:auto;max-height:500px;}.menu2_{border:1px solid #858749;width:100%;height:35px;line-height:35px;text-indent:10px;display:none;}@media all and (max-width: 1200px){.content__left_box{display:none;}.menu2_{display:block;}.product_list_left,.product_list_right{width:100%;float:none;padding:0;}.content__left,.content__right.category{width:100%;float:none;}.content__right.category,.content__right.products,.content__right.products_info{width:100%;}.product_list_right{margin-top:10px;}.product_short_desc{margin-bottom:20px;max-height:inherit;}.category_title{margin-top:20px;margin-bottom:20px;}.content__right.products_info{margin-top:20px;}.content__left .content__left_box{width:100%;}.content__right.products ul li{width:calc(50% - 10px);}.content__right.products ul li:nth-of-type(odd){padding-right:10px;}.content__right.products ul li:nth-of-type(even){padding-left:10px;}}@media all and (max-width: 900px){.content__right.category ul li,.content__right.products ul li{width:100%;}.content__right.products ul li:nth-of-type(odd),.content__right.products ul li:nth-of-type(even){padding:0;}}